A 60-year-old Bhayander resident died after suffering a heart attack while waiting to withdraw money from a cooperative bank in Bhayander on Wednesday. The family of Deepak Shah said he had been going to the bank for the past three days, but had failed to withdraw cash. An accidental death report has been filed at Bhayander police station.
The incident took place at around 6:45 am on Wednesday. Shah had woken up early and reached Bassein Catholic Cooperative bank located in Bhayander West. As he waited there, he reportedly suffered a heart attack and collapsed. He was rushed to hospital where he was declared dead.
